Principal Software Engineer- REMOTE

Remote Full-time
At Thorne, we work to deliver high-quality, science-backed solutions to empower individuals to take a proactive approach to their well-being. Each day begins with a mission to help others discover and achieve their best health. We count on our team members to challenge and push the boundaries to make that happen. At Thorne, you’ll be joining a team of more than 750 passionate individuals committed to our cause of providing superior health solutions at every age and life stage. Position Summary: The Principal Software Engineer works strategically with stakeholders to align technology resources with business goals while directing themselves and others in the execution of technical strategy. The role will be responsible for platform strategy, architecture, and hands-on development of strategic technology assets. This is a remote position. Responsibilities • Works with Thorne business and technology leadership on strategic technical vision for the company, and work with cross functional stakeholders, vendors and partners to achieve said vision. • Designs, develops, deploys, and operates fault tolerant, high performance integrations with internal and third-party systems. • Assists in the development, testing, and implementation of enhancements to the company’s software platform(s). • Understands the evolving security, compliance and regulatory environments with key focus on ensuring we proactively eliminate vulnerabilities. • Advocates for improving the customer experience, by establishing metrics and process for regular assessment and improvements. • Helps with leadership recruiting efforts for hiring senior engineers and managers. • Provides technical leadership and mentoring to Thorne’s development staff. • Effectively communicates to executives and business owners as well as system users. • Stays current on technology trends and new software solutions. What You Need • Advanced degree in Computer Science, Math, Physics or equivalent industry experience -AND/OR- 8+ years of experience in a modern statically typed language (Java, Scala, Go, etc.) is required. • Knowledge of Salesforce, MuleSoft, JavaScript, HTML, SQL, CSS, and cloud computing services. • A strong grasp of data structures and algorithms. Experience working with / presenting to business stakeholders. Thorne is the leader in science-backed health and wellness solutions committed to helping individuals live healthier longer. As the top recommended clinical brand by healthcare practitioners, Thorne offers a comprehensive range of products including nutritional supplements and health tests designed to meet the unique needs of individuals at every stage of life. Founded in 1984, Thorne products are formulated with the highest-quality ingredients, supported by clinical research, and rigorously tested to ensure purity, potency, and efficacy. Thorne is trusted by 47,000+ health-care professionals, thousands of professional athletes, more than 100 professional sports teams, multiple U.S. National Teams, and more than five million consumers. For more information, visit Thorne.com. THORNE IS AN EQUAL OPPORTUNITY EMPLOYER Apply tot his job
Apply Now →

Similar Jobs

Experienced Registered Behavior Technician for In-Home ABA Therapy - Atlanta, GA

Remote

Immediate Hiring: Experienced Registered Behavioral Technician (RBT) for Clinic-Based ABA Therapy Services

Remote

Experienced Registered Behavioral Technician (RBT) - ABA Therapy for Children with Autism Spectrum Disorder

Remote

Experienced Registered Nurse - Telehealth: Providing Remote Care Coordination and Patient Support

Remote

Experienced Substitute Teacher for Riverside County Schools - Join Scoot Education's Innovative Team

Remote

Experienced Substitute Teacher for San Bernardino County - Flexible Schedules & Competitive Pay

Remote

Experienced School Year Instructional Coach for High-Dosage Tutoring Programs in Edgewater Park, NJ

Remote

Experienced School Year Tutor for K-8 Students in Math and Literacy - Mickleton, NJ

Remote

Experienced Secondary Social Studies Teacher for Kansas - Flexible Hybrid Remote Arrangement

Remote

USPS Office Helper

Remote

Accounts Receivable Specialist – Physician Billing, Hybrid Remote Available for Local (PA, NJ) C…

Remote

customer service associate II

Remote

Experienced Product Reviewer and Tester for Innovative Products - Fully Remote Opportunity with Competitive Compensation

Remote

Chemical Engineer/Environmental Engineer/Scientist – Entry Level – Permitting and Compliance Focus (Hybrid)

Remote

Experienced Customer Care Chat Representative for Remote Work Opportunities - $25-$35/hr - Entry-Level Live Chat Support Specialist

Remote

Experienced Regional Vice President of Field Sales - West for Education Technology Leader

Remote

Remote Search Analyst for Innovative Data Analysis Projects in Spain - Work from Home Opportunity

Remote

Analyst, Service Desk (Contract)

Remote

Entry/Junior Level Data Analyst/Scientist

Remote

Senior Economist, Amazon Pharmacy

Remote
← Back